L&T Construction bags Rs 5,220 crore orders

No Comments Sub Category:Infrastructure Posted On: Mar 04, 2014

In the first two months of this year across various business segments, L&T Construction has received an order worth Rs 5,220 crore.

S N Subrahmanyan, Senior Executive Vice President (Infrastructure and Construction), L&T said in his speech, “It has been a productive beginning to the New Year and these orders reaffirm our leadership position in our various business verticals.”

From Gujarat, Karnataka and West Bengal, the water and renewable energy business segment has got the highest order of Rs 2,019 crore. The buildings and factories division has got orders worth Rs 1,461 crore from West Bengal, Chhattisgarh and Maharashtra.

The Rs 1,001 crore order is both from India and abroad. National Highways Authority of India, Department of Atomic Energy, gave a new order worth Rs 739 crore to Heavy Civil Infrastructure Business.

Subrahmanyan added “Although there is still sluggishness in our economy, these orders reflect that there is some positive movement in the infrastructure sector which augurs well for both the country and L&T going forward.”
